South Av & MacDade Blvd

Advertisement

507 W South Ave
Glenolden, PA 19036

This bus stop at South Av & MacDade Blvd is a convenient spot for commuters in Glenolden, PA to catch their rides.

Generated from this place's information

Own this business?
See a problem?

You might also like

United StatesPennsylvaniaGlenoldenSouth Av & MacDade Blvd

Advertisement